This image is a DNA coloring worksheet designed to help students visualize and understand the structure of the DNA double helix by coloring its components according to specific instructions.

## 🧬 STEP 1: Color the Sugar-Phosphate Backbone

> Instruction:
> *Color each deoxyribose sugar RED*
> *Color each phosphate group BLUE*

Solution:


- Deoxyribose sugars are the 5-carbon sugar rings that form the “backbone” of each DNA strand, alternating with phosphate groups.
- In the diagram, these are typically shown as pentagons (or simplified shapes) along the outer edges of the double helix.
- Color all deoxyribose sugars RED.
- Phosphate groups connect the sugars and are usually shown as small circles or ovals between the sugars.
- Color all phosphate groups BLUE.

➡️ This creates the classic “twisted ladder” backbone — red and blue alternating on both sides.

## 🧬 STEP 2: Color the Nitrogenous Bases

> Instruction:
> *Color the thymine (T) GREEN*
> *Color the adenine (A) ORANGE*
> *Color the guanine (G) PURPLE*
> *Color the cytosine (C) PINK*

Solution:


- Inside the DNA ladder are the base pairs, connected by hydrogen bonds.
- According to Chargaff’s rules, bases pair specifically:
- Adenine (A) always pairs with Thymine (T)
- Guanine (G) always pairs with Cytosine (C)

So, find each base in the diagram and color them:

| Base | Color |
|------|---------|
| A | ORANGE |
| T | GREEN |
| G | PURPLE |
| C | PINK |

➡️ You should see orange-green pairs and purple-pink pairs throughout the helix.

---

## 🧬 STEP 3: Color the Hydrogen Bonds

> Instruction:
> *Color the ___ hydrogen bonds between A and T BLACK*
> *Color the ___ hydrogen bonds between G and C WHITE*

Solution:


You need to fill in the blanks based on biology knowledge.

- A-T pair is held together by 2 hydrogen bonds
- G-C pair is held together by 3 hydrogen bonds

So:

> *Color the 2 hydrogen bonds between A and T BLACK*
> *Color the 3 hydrogen bonds between G and C WHITE*

➡️ In the diagram, look for the short lines connecting the base pairs — those are the hydrogen bonds. Color them accordingly.

## 🧠 Why This Matters:

This activity reinforces key concepts:
- DNA has a sugar-phosphate backbone (red + blue).
- The bases carry genetic information and follow strict pairing rules (A-T, G-C).
- Hydrogen bonds hold the strands together — and their number affects DNA stability (G-C pairs are stronger due to 3 bonds).
